Attention-grabbing Palestine question on '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?'
A 1 million TL question about Palestine on the game show '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?', broadcast on Atv, has become a topic of discussion.
In the new episode of the popular game show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?, hosted by actor Kenan İmirzalıoğlu, a 1 million TL question about Palestine drew attention.

In the episode, which highlighted the conflicts between Israel and Palestine, contestant Eyüp İşler, who reached the 12th question on the prize ladder, was asked: "Following Israel's ban on the Palestinian flag and its colors in the occupied Palestinian territories, which of the following became a symbol of protest, and those who carried it in the streets were arrested for a period?"

The options were A) Hulk poster, B) Watermelon slice, C) Red carnation, D) Cedar tree branch.
The watermelon is known as a symbol of the Palestinians. This symbol, which emerged after Israel took control of the West Bank and Gaza following the Six-Day War in 1967, spread further after the annexation of East Jerusalem. The Israeli government had criminalized the public display of the Palestinian flag in Gaza and the West Bank.
EARNED THE RIGHT TO SEE THE 5 MILLION TL QUESTION
The contestant answered with "watermelon slice." Having found the correct answer, Eyüp İşler earned the right to see the 13th question, worth 5 million TL, which is the grand prize of the competition.

PALESTINE COMMENT FROM KENAN İMİRZALIOĞLU
Host Kenan İmirzalıoğlu, who did not remain silent about the humanitarian tragedy in Gaza, where Israel has been raining bombs for a month, stated: "I hope peace comes and the death of civilians ends. The death of civilians breaks all of our hearts. The whole world is watching the events in Gaza with one eye closed and one ear plugged. They are not standing by the side of the righteous. I hope the countries that see themselves as great will end this in a conscientious way. We are praying for the people there. We cannot bear to watch the footage; our hearts are burning."
